tests: shrink feature_taproot transfer of funds tx #20428

pull ajtowns wants to merge 1 commits into bitcoin:master from ajtowns:202011-test-taproot-signmany changing 1 files +10 −4
  1. ajtowns commented at 8:13 PM on November 19, 2020: member

    When moving funds from node 1 to node 0 for the pre-activation tests, there can be a large number of inputs, potentially resulting in a tx that is larger than standardness rules allow, or that takes a long time to sign. This just takes the top 500 outputs, which is plenty (~90% of the wallet balance).

  2. DrahtBot added the label Tests on Nov 19, 2020
  3. luke-jr approved
  4. luke-jr commented at 8:52 PM on November 19, 2020: member

    tACK e68d3324f7ce821516b7b232cdd74add861ae78e

  5. jonatack commented at 8:57 PM on November 19, 2020: member

    Concept ACK, testing.

  6. ajtowns force-pushed on Nov 19, 2020
  7. jonatack commented at 9:15 PM on November 19, 2020: member

    On a sluggish Intel Core i7-6500U CPU @ 2.50GHz × 4, two runs each, ~28 seconds faster

    master
    real	4m8.402s
    user	5m30.459s
    sys     0m12.095s
    
    patch
    real	3m39.194s
    user	4m52.800s
    sys	    0m12.868s
    
    master
    real	3m58.595s
    user	5m15.567s
    sys	    0m12.140s
    
    patch
    real	3m31.601s
    user	4m47.992s
    sys	    0m12.036s
    
  8. luke-jr commented at 9:18 PM on November 19, 2020: member

    re-tACK ed8745a6f827791aee55764b44682fea8987017d

  9. jonatack commented at 9:24 PM on November 19, 2020: member

    ACK ed8745a6f827791aee55764b44682fea8987017d

  10. tests: shrink feature_taproot transfer of funds tx 7ffac12545
  11. ajtowns force-pushed on Nov 19, 2020
  12. ajtowns commented at 9:36 PM on November 19, 2020: member

    Rebased further back in history so it's easy to backport to 0.21, and simplified to just pick the 500 unspents with the highest amount, rather than doing many transactions.

  13. ajtowns renamed this:
    tests: split feature_taproot transfer of funds into smaller txs
    tests: shrink feature_taproot transfer of funds tx
    on Nov 19, 2020
  14. luke-jr commented at 10:24 PM on November 19, 2020: member

    utACK 7ffac12545328cadd92a3caec4f1c6ca7c127493

  15. sipa commented at 10:26 PM on November 19, 2020: member

    utACK

  16. MarcoFalke added the label Needs backport (0.21) on Nov 20, 2020
  17. MarcoFalke added this to the milestone 0.21.1 on Nov 20, 2020
  18. MarcoFalke removed this from the milestone 0.21.1 on Nov 20, 2020
  19. MarcoFalke added this to the milestone 0.21.0 on Nov 20, 2020
  20. MarcoFalke commented at 8:28 AM on November 20, 2020: member

    cr ACK 7ffac12545328cadd92a3caec4f1c6ca7c127493

  21. MarcoFalke merged this on Nov 20, 2020
  22. MarcoFalke closed this on Nov 20, 2020

  23. MarcoFalke removed the label Needs backport (0.21) on Nov 20, 2020
  24. MarcoFalke commented at 8:33 AM on November 20, 2020: member

    backported in #20431

  25. MarcoFalke referenced this in commit bf9548bc59 on Nov 20, 2020
  26. sidhujag referenced this in commit b6d7c2bd4b on Nov 20, 2020
  27. DrahtBot locked this on Feb 15, 2022

github-metadata-mirror

This is a metadata mirror of the GitHub repository bitcoin/bitcoin. This site is not affiliated with GitHub. Content is generated from a GitHub metadata backup.
generated: 2026-04-17 06:14 UTC

This site is hosted by @0xB10C
More mirrored repositories can be found on mirror.b10c.me